Baylor Scott & White Liver Consultants of Texas - Waxahachie
- Address
- 1505 W Jefferson Street
- Ste 160
- Place
- Waxahachie , TX 75165
Description
Baylor Scott & White Liver Consultants of Texas - Waxahachie can be found at 1505 W Jefferson Street . The following is offered: Doctors & Clinics - In Waxahachie there are 71 other Doctors & Clinics. An overview can be found here.
Reviews
This listing was not reviewed yet